Output 76586488b30d9e9912ec97071108dac76c3338fb9c2b0b6c167fdf797b504692:1

value
19852
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59401b045f4b62f29b61c8ed5a8651af8ee6d1a4 OP_EQUAL
address
39pvrkJLtapM2pQiDxWC4VKEctueTZn2nH
transaction
76586488b30d9e9912ec97071108dac76c3338fb9c2b0b6c167fdf797b504692
spent
true